In a move toward inclusive and equitable professional education, MBA programs have been launched in regional languages. These offerings leverage AI‑enabled translation technology to deliver study materials fully localized in multiple vernaculars, eliminating language barriers and opening such programs to a broader demographic.
The pilot rollout covers two languages, with plans to expand into ten more by the end of the year. The initiative aligns with national policy goals encouraging education in native tongues. Government officials and program leaders have praised the step as transformative, noting that high-quality business education is now available to professionals in their mother tongues—a critical shift in accessibility and inclusion across diverse language communities.
